Transaction 7155831970ed050756c612c0b6e98f1986f6bdeba301c4de033f339c0aab08f3
1 Input
1 Output
-
7155831970ed050756c612c0b6e98f1986f6bdeba301c4de033f339c0aab08f3: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6f81173f762e9bb854e9ad84dd67b9901984ded723dfa4e6fc05e443b415aa3a
- address
- bc1pd7q3w0mk96dms48f4kzd6eaejqvcfhkhy006fehuqhjy8dq44gaqus3398